#58778d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58778d is composed of 34.5% red, 46.7%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.6% cyan, 15.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 204.9 degrees, a saturation of 23.1% and a lightness of 44.9%. #58778d color hex could be obtained by blending #b0eeff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#58778d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58778d has RGB values of R:88, G:119,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 5797773.

Shades and Tints of #58778d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050708 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fd is the lightest one.
